Office Mode IP Pools CANNOT be part of the subnet of your internal networks, however with the later versions of AI, they can be part of the encryption domain.
Your internal routers must know to send all Office Mode IPs tothe firewall. Assume you have assigned 192.168.100.0 255.255.255.0 to the Office Mode IP Pool and this is outside of your internal subnet.
From your work computer, without using SecureClient, a
tracert 192.168.100.5
should end up back at the firewall internal interface. If not, you'll have to adjust your internal routers appropriately. Note that Office Mode is a SecureClient feature and does not work with SecuRemote.
If you change the Office Mode IP Pool range, I believe you have to reboot thegateway as well.

I hope someone can clear a problem for me. We need to use office mode to assign ip address to clients. Without office mode everything works fine, I can get a connection with a secureremote client to our firewall and ping any address behind it and all trafic passes trough without problems. When I enable office mode I get authorised by the firewall but afterwards there is no traffic possible trough the tunnel. When I setup office mode to use a ip pool outside the subnet of our internal side of the firewall the connection fails. In the log I only see that I am authenticated successfull and I get a ip address assigned but then it ends. When I setup office mode to use a ip pool inside the subnet of our internal side of the firewall I get a connection but there is no traffic possible trough that tunnel. I have a new network adapter with a ip address from the pool but nothing happens. On the firewall I see no traffic but only sometimes a broadcast from that client on the subnet. On the clients log viewer I get the message: encryption fail reason::Packet if from physical ip address but office mode is active.
I have read the office mode documents on and on but cannot find why its not working. Anyone with an idea is welcome, thanx in advance.
